Output 81f32d5c159f0b15d41de302e65ea8a0cf69da8d36d623dcbbd252533d860cf6:1

value
23149223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a6105e667323d764092752760cdb4376662031 OP_EQUAL
address
9yyH1SkDDPESuWDYBV1LkGoM4h4rWBB5iC
transaction
81f32d5c159f0b15d41de302e65ea8a0cf69da8d36d623dcbbd252533d860cf6